Statuary meaning in Urdu

Statuary Definitions

1 of 2) Statuary : مجسمہ سازی : (noun) statues collectively.

2 of 2) Statuary : مجسمہ سازی سے متعلق : (adjective) of or relating to or suitable for statues.
